Arsh Kaur Email and Phone Number
Experienced IT professional, in developing enterprise single page applications, using React, NodeJS, Typescript, and JavaScript. Expertise in developing user-centric websites, elegant user interactions, clean code and reusability.PROFESSIONAL SUMMARY• Experience in all the phases of Software Development Life Cycle by being a part of complete end-to-end development process, which includes requirements gathering with stakeholders, planning, research, design, coding, testing, and deployment• Proficient in developing User Interfaces using technologies like React, Redux, Typescript, JavaScript, HTML5, CSS3, NodeJS, Bootstrap, Material UI, JSON, AJAX, RESTful Services, Elastic, GIT, SVN, Webpack, Power BI, GCP etc.• Experience working with Redux architecture to manage complex application state and perform side effects using middleware’s• Experience in integrating RESTful APIs to populate the data for CRUD (create, read, update, and delete) operations on client side• Excellent experience working in Agile environment and participating in all its ceremonies - sprint planning, daily scrum meetings, sprint retrospective, backlog grooming, etc.• Ability to write clear, well-documented, well-commented and efficient code for web development.
Walmart Canada
View- Website:
- walmart.ca
- Employees:
- 9280
-
Sr. DeveloperWalmart Canada Feb 2023 - Present• Developed Quality Compliance Web Application with React.js, Redux, Node.js (Express.js), SQL server and SSMS• Built functional components using React hooks out of design prototypes• Managed application state with Redux architecture using Reducers, Actions, Selectors and middleware.• Used React Router to create a SPA which can bind data to specific views and synchronize data with server.• Improved UI performance by identifying bottlenecks, by making use of Redux and React Hooks.• Worked on SQL Server (SSMS) to create schemas, tables, views, stored procedures, functions for DB development• Involved in development of RESTFUL web-service APIs using Node.js, created new API’s as per the requirements to perform CRUD operations• Used Postman to test API, used GIT as version control tool and Power BI to create reports and dashboards.• Participated in Agile methodology for application development & used JIRA as project management tool. -
Sr. DeveloperTd Dec 2020 - Jan 2023• Worked on Dashboard using React, Redux, Typescript, NodeJS (Express), Material UI• Translated high-fidelity mock-ups into functional user interfaces using React hooks• Developed reusable components and custom React Hooks to make the SPA lean and efficient.• Implemented React JS components, Forms, Events, Keys, Router, Animations, and Flux concepts• Managed application state with Redux using Reducers, Actions, Selectors and Saga middleware.• Implemented routing using React Router and protected authenticated routes• Integrated Restful API to consume endpoints on client side to perform different operations• Setup pagination to load large data set without impacting application performance• Worked on server-side using NodeJS to create new API’s as per the requirements, optimized existing API’s and performed CRUD operations• Interacted with Testing Team, Scrum Masters and Business Analysts for fixing of issues -
Sr. DeveloperDell Technologies Mar 2019 - Nov 2020• Created multiple Single Page Applications (SPAs) using React, TypeScript and Material UI• Worked on React applications, following ES6 pattern by creating classes and interfaces • Built functional components using React hooks out of design prototypes• Hands on working experience with various React hooks (useState, useEffect, useContext etc.) to create lean, efficient and maintainable code• Implemented React Context using useContext hook to create global state in an application which is available to various components regardless of nesting level • Created microservices using NodeJS to handle API’s performing CRUD operations – created migrations, models, routes and MySQL database in cloud• Involved in all the phases of System Development life cycle (SDLC) including Analysis, Design, Coding, Testing, Implementation and Support • Coordinated with the team in daily routine works as a part of agile methodology, participated in SCRUM meetings -
Frontend DeveloperRona Mar 2017 - Feb 2019• Enhanced client’s enterprise web application using web development technologies like React, Redux, JavaScript, Typescript, HTML5 and CSS3• Implemented stable React components and stand-alone functions to be added to any future pages• Worked with Redux architecture to manage the state in the entire application and for easy retrieval of data to any component in the app• Used Redux Store to store the data globally using Action and Reducer functions and applied middleware such as redux-saga• Implemented accessibility standards to make app accessible for screen-readers etc.• Integrated React and Redux developer tools to help in debugging of the application• Day to day use of Jira for bug tracking and issue tracking• Participated in SCRUM meetings like Sprint Planning, daily stand-ups, grooming sessions, sprint retrospective etc. following agile methodologies. -
Ui DeveloperPaycom Mar 2016 - Feb 2017• Responsible for upgrading legacy application using React, JavaScript, HTML5, CSS3, Bootstrap, etc.• Experience in implementing client-side registration forms, login forms and logout forms validation• Implemented routing using React-Router to manage different routes in application • Enhanced the existing user interface with Bootstrap and refined CSS styling• Experience working in fast paced Agile Environment and worked with the Project Management tool like JIRA• Worked on testing, debugging and browser troubleshooting the existing code using chrome developer tools• Participated in various SCRUM ceremonies throughout the project implementation
Frequently Asked Questions about Arsh Kaur
What company does Arsh Kaur work for?
Arsh Kaur works for Walmart Canada
What is Arsh Kaur's role at the current company?
Arsh Kaur's current role is Sr. Software Developer specializing in React, Angular and Node.js.
Who are Arsh Kaur's colleagues?
Arsh Kaur's colleagues are Jeff Read, Navneet Basra, Mark Morgan, Hany Wassily, Daytona Chalifoux, Drashya Patel, Hitendrakumar Patel.
Not the Arsh Kaur you were looking for?
Free Chrome Extension
Find emails, phones & company data instantly
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ial